A cookie recipe calls for 3 cups of sugar and yields 24 cookies how much sugar will be needed to make 3 dozen cookies

Answer:4.5 cups of sugar

Step-by-step explanation:

Okay so 24 cookies is 2 dozen

1 cup of sugar would be used for every 8 cookies

3 dozen is equal to 36 cookies

36/8=4.5 so you would need 4.5 cups of sugar
